Recognizing the Issue

The initial stage of recovery is frequently the hardest: conceding that you struggle with alcoholism. This confession is not an indication of frailty but instead a courageous recognition of the truth and a vital initial move in pursuit of assistance. Acknowledging the negative effects that alcohol consumption has inflicted on your own life and on others can be tough, yet it’s a necessary step for the healing process to start.

Consulting with Experts

After recognizing the issue, the subsequent vital move is to consult with experts. Alcoholism is a multifaceted illness with varying impacts on individuals, making advice and support from medical professionals, addiction counselors, or psychotherapists extremely crucial. They are equipped to conduct evaluations, suggest possible treatments, and assist through the stages of detox, rehab, and further recovery processes.

Detoxification

Detoxification involves the body eliminating alcohol, a step often filled with difficulty due to a spectrum of withdrawal symptoms from light to intense. It’s critical to have medical oversight during this period to guarantee safety and to receive medications that can alleviate the discomfort of withdrawal, thus simplifying the detox process.

Rehabilitation Programs

Rehab programs, available as both residential and non-residential options, provide a well-organized framework of care and assistance. Aimed at aiding people in grasping the nature of their substance dependence, these initiatives foster the creation of effective management techniques and the establishment of a solid support circle. Regular therapeutic discussions, group interactions, and learning seminars form the core of these rehabilitation efforts, concentrating equally on the physical aspects of recuperation and the psychological restoration process.

Continuing Therapy and Treatment

Recovering from alcoholism is a journey that persists beyond detoxification or rehabilitation. Consistent participation in therapy or counseling is essential to tackle the root causes of alcohol dependence and assist in navigating life’s difficulties without turning to alcohol as a coping mechanism.

Avoiding Triggers

Recognizing and steering clear of situations that could lead to a relapse is essential. This might involve avoiding specific social settings, reassessing relationships, or discovering alternative methods to manage stress and emotional challenges. Being able to identify the warning signs of a potential relapse and having strategies in place can assist in maintaining your recovery journey.

FAQs

  1. What are the first steps someone should take when they realize they have a problem with alcohol?

  • Acknowledging the issue and seeking professional help are the crucial initial steps. This can involve reaching out to a healthcare provider, therapist, or addiction specialist for guidance and support.

  1. Is detoxification necessary for everyone recovering from alcoholism?

  • Detoxification may be necessary for some individuals, especially those with severe alcohol dependence. It involves allowing the body to rid itself of alcohol under medical supervision to manage withdrawal symptoms safely.

  1. What types of rehabilitation programs are available for individuals recovering from alcoholism?

  • Rehabilitation programs vary in intensity and duration and can be either inpatient or outpatient. They often include therapy sessions, group meetings, and educational workshops to address the physical, emotional, and psychological aspects of alcohol addiction.
